TRAFFIC ADVISORY - Today’s Winter Snow Storm May Produce Flooding
Drivers Are Asked to Observe No Parking on Snow-Covered Roadways and to Avoid Flooded Streets.

Drivers are also asked to observe the No Parking on Snow-Covered Roadways signs that have been posted on streets throughout the City of Newark. Motorists are urged to look for the sign pictured below to identify the streets designated for no parking.
The Department of Public Safety is coordinating responses to burglar alarms, flooding, and other weather-related incidents through the combined efforts of Police, Fire, and the Office of Emergency Management. Special attention should be given to unsecured outdoor furniture, awnings, refuse, and building materials.
For fire safety, please use flashlights instead of candles if you lose power due to this weather event. For non-emergency weather-related incidents, call: 973-733-6000. For emergencies, Dial 911. #newarknj #publicsafety #snowstorms
